Analysis

Ecuador recorded 2.56 billion current LCU for net acquisition of financial assets in 2022.

The figure is down 37.9% on the previous year and up 194.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, net acquisition of financial assets in Ecuador peaked at 4.12 billion current LCU in 2021 and was at its lowest, -130.12 million current LCU, in 2014.

Ecuador ranks 67th of 134 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Net acquisition of government financial assets includes domestic and foreign financial claims, SDRs, and gold bullion held by monetary authorities as a reserve asset. The net acquisition of financial assets should be offset by the net incurrence of liabilities.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This series is expressed in local currency units.
